Understanding the FedEx Business Model and Its Impact on Pay

To dig the realism of a FedEx Driver Salary, you must first understand the differentiation between FedEx Express and FedEx Ground. This structural difference is the single bad factor influencing how much a driver earns and how their benefits are structured.

  • FedEx Express: These drivers are direct employees of the corporation. They typically receive a competitory hourly salary, comprehensive health benefits, retreat plans, and structure overtime pay.
  • FedEx Ground: Drivers in this sector are generally not employed by FedEx immediately. Alternatively, they act for Independent Service Providers (ISPs). These contractor own the route and are responsible for hiring, firing, and setting the recompense for their drivers.

Because of this split, there is no individual "FedEx remuneration". An Express driver might have a highly predictable income with corporate perks, while a Ground driver's earnings might be bind more nearly to performance, bringing volume, or a negotiated casual rate with their specific employer.

Key Factors That Influence Your Earnings

Beyond the elementary understructure rate, respective variables can significantly switch the total annual FedEx Driver Salary. Savvy drivers look at the next factor when evaluating job fling:

  • Route Concentration: In urban region where stops are nigh together, driver can complete more bringing in less clip, oft leave to execution fillip if the declarer offers them.
  • Experience and Licensing: Make a CDL Class A permit open the threshold to long-haul, feeder, and heavy-freight routes, which systematically pay importantly higher than standard residential parcel delivery.
  • Geographical Fix: Driver in metropolitan hub or province with high minimum wage laws will course see higher entry-level pay compared to those in rural area.
  • Peak Season Bonuses: During the vacation spate, many declarer offer seasonal incentives, per-stop bonuses, or overtime opportunity that can provide a monolithic boost to one-year income.

The Role of Benefits in Total Compensation

When analyzing a FedEx Driver Salary, do not disregard the "hidden" paycheck - benefits. For FedEx Express employees, the benefits package is often a significant parcel of the entire value proffer. This includes health insurance, dental, sight, living policy, and a 401 (k) lucifer. These benefits can add an eq of $ 10,000 to $ 15,000 in value to the substructure salary.

For FedEx Ground drivers working for ISPs, the benefits situation is more varied. Some bigger contractors offer robust benefit, while small-scale contractors might focus solely on the base daily pace. When survey an offering, always ask about health insurance donation and pay clip off, as these play a critical role in your long-term fiscal health.

💡 Tone: Sovereign declarer are ofttimes creditworthy for their own tax withholdings. If you are accepting a daily pace from an ISP, ensure you have calculated your take-home pay after account for self-employment taxation or necessary deductions.
